Day 1 - From London to Madrid

We depart from St Pancras International by Eurostar for Paris, travelling in Standard Premier Class with a light meal and drinks served on board. We cross the city by coach to board the Francisco de Goya sleeper train for a journey through the night to Madrid in two-berth Preferente Class compartments. (E)


Day 2 - Madrid to Seville

Breakfast is served on board the train this morning before our arrival into Madrid. We change trains in Madrid, travelling south into Andalucia on the high-speed AVE service to Seville, a unique and captivating city which provides the backdrop for the classic opera Carmen and is also the home of Flamenco. On arrival in the city we transfer by coach to the 4-star Hotel Hesperia, where we spend the night. (B,D)


Day 3 - Seville to Cordoba on Al Andalus Express

You have this morning to explore Seville at leisure before we transfer to Santa Justa railway station, where we board the sumptuous Al Andalus Express luxury hotel train. After a welcome reception on board and chance to settle into your cabin, we begin our journey, travelling the short distance to Cordoba whilst enjoying lunch on board. On arrival in Cordoba we embark on a sightseeing tour, passing the 14th century Calahorra Tower, exploring the narrow streets of the Jewish Quarter and taking in the Mezquita - the grandest and most beautiful mosque ever constructed. You are then free to explore the city further at your own pace before we meet for dinner in a typical local restaurant. (B,L,D)


Day 4 - Baeza

Today we visit two of Spain's Renaissance cities; Baeza and Ubeda. We arrive into Linares-Baeza as we enjoy breakfast on board the train. The beautiful town of Baeza enjoys an incredible setting surrounded by Europe's biggest olive tree plantation; we visit the Museum of Olive Oil on our arrival. We then explore the Old Town in Baeza, a delightful, compact centre of cobbled streets and paved squares filled with beautiful Renaissance architecture and highly decorative façades. We return to the train and head to the city of Ubeda, enjoying lunch before our tour of the city. After some free time to explore at leisure, we return to the train and enjoy dinner on board as we continue through the beautiful countryside towards Granada, a beautiful town located at the foot of the Sierra Nevada Mountains. (B,L,D)


Day 5 - Granada

Granada's stunning Alhambra is world-renowned for its beauty. Built in the 14th century, the Alhambra, literally 'the red castle', is a fortress, palace and small town all rolled into one. The Alhambra became the residence of royalty in the middle of the 13th century, and over the next few centuries the fortress became a citadel. We also explore the breathtaking Generalife Gardens which cover the whole summit of the hill. Following lunch we explore Granada, including the Albayzin, the ancient Moorish quarter of the city which housed the artists who built the acclaimed palaces in the ancient city of Elvira, the original name of Granada before it was re-christened by the Moors. Following some free time to explore at leisure, we visit a local restaurant for dinner and enjoy a traditional flamenco show - the seductive dance which originated in Andalucia. (B,L,D)


Day 6 - Ronda and Cadiz

During breakfast on board we travel through the stunning scenery of the Sierra Nevada Mountains. We head towards Ronda, an historic town divided in two by its impressive gorge. We enjoy a tour of the town, including the beautiful Casa Bosco, with its terraced gardens, and the Puente Nuevo, which has fabulous panoramic views over the surrounding mountains and the incredible gorge, almost 100m deep. After lunch, we continue our journey to Cadiz, one of the oldest European cities, with a remarkable heritage. (B,L,D)


Day 7 - Jerez and Guadalquivir River Cruise

As breakfast is being served we arrive in Jerez, a town famous as the home of Sherry and for the training of beautiful Andalucian horses. Jerez is the authentic heart of Andalucia, with a beautiful Gothic cathedral and quiet, charming Old Town. We enjoy a tour of a local sherry producer, including a tour of the wine cellars. We then enjoy a spectacular Andalucian horse show at the Royal School of Equestrian Art, seeing some of the best-trained horses in the world in action. After lunch we travel to the town of Sanlucar de Barrameda, located at the mouth of the Guadalquivir River. Here we enjoy a river-boat cruise through the Doñana National Park, Europe's largest nature reserve. We return to Jerez this afternoon, where you have some free time to explore at leisure. The Alcazar, a former Moorish fortress, is well worth a visit. Otherwise, Jerez boasts a pretty old quarter with beautiful palm lined squares, excellent tapas bars and genteel boulevards, so you may just wish to relax and go for a stroll in the area. Tonight we enjoy a farewell evening on board while the train remains in Jerez. (B,L,D)


Day 8 - Seville

We arrive in the historic city of Seville this morning, the final destination of our journey on Al Andalus. We enjoy a sightseeing tour of the city, including the immense Gothic cathedral, the burial place of Christopher Columbus, which is dominated by the Giralda Tower - a former Moorish minaret. We also visit the impressive Plaza de España, originally built for the World Fair of 1929. Later in the day, we disembark Al Andalus Express and return to the Hotel Hesperia for an overnight stay. (B)


Day 9 - Seville to Barcelona

We leave Seville by rail this morning, travelling in Preferente class on the high-speed AVE service through the heart of Spain to Barcelona. On arrival in Barcelona we transfer to our hotel, the 4-star Tryp Apolo hotel. Our early afternoon arrival leaves plenty of time to explore the city at leisure. Perhaps take a walk through the Gothic quarter, or discover bustling Port Vell, literally 'Old Harbour'. This evening we enjoy dinner at Can Travi Nou restaurant, located in an idyllic 17th century farmhouse on the outskirts of Barcelona. (B,D)

If returning by air, you will transfer to Malaga airport for the return flight to London. (B)


Day 10 - Barcelona to London

We make a short rail journey from Barcelona to Figueres, where we board the direct TGV service to Paris. After crossing Paris by coach we connect with the Eurostar to London. A light meal and drinks are served on board ahead of our arrival into St Pancras International. (B,E)
